Netflix: A Holiday Movie Powerhouse
Netflix has become a major player in the holiday movies game, offering a mix of original productions and beloved classics. Their original holiday films have gained a dedicated following, some becoming instant classics, while others… well, let’s just say they provide ample fodder for spirited debate. The sheer volume of their offerings makes it a reliable choice for anyone looking to stream holiday movies.
You can find everything from cheesy rom-coms set against snowy backdrops to animated adventures that capture the spirit of the season. Netflix’s algorithm is also pretty good at suggesting new Christmas movies based on your viewing history, meaning you’re likely to discover some hidden gems you might not have found otherwise.

But here’s a tip: don’t rely solely on the “Holiday Movies” category. Sometimes, Netflix’s categorization can be a little quirky. Try searching for specific keywords like “Christmas,” “Winter,” or even “Santa” to unearth even more festive films. And remember, Netflix’s catalog changes regularly, so check back often to see what new holiday movies have been added. “I love that Netflix keeps adding new movies,” says Mark, a regular user. “It gives me something fresh to watch every year.”
Amazon Prime Video: A Treasure Trove of Festive Films
Amazon Prime Video offers a vast library of holiday movies, including both rentals and titles available through Prime membership. This makes it a versatile option for finding your favorite seasonal flicks. One of the great things about Amazon Prime Video is its selection of classic Christmas movies. You can find timeless tales like “It’s a Wonderful Life” and “Miracle on 34th Street,” perfect for those who appreciate a touch of nostalgia during the holidays.

Beyond the classics, Amazon Prime Video also features a growing collection of original holiday movies and family-friendly options. Keep an eye out for special deals and promotions, as Amazon often offers discounts on rentals and purchases during the holiday season. Plus, if you’re already a Prime member, you’ll have access to a significant portion of their Christmas movies library at no extra cost. Just be sure to double-check whether a movie is included with your Prime membership or requires an additional rental fee before you settle in for your viewing. Disney+: Holiday Magic for the Whole Family
If you’re looking for family-friendly holiday movies, Disney+ is a must-have. From animated classics like “Mickey’s Christmas Carol” to live-action favorites like “The Santa Clause,” Disney+ offers a treasure trove of heartwarming and festive films that will delight audiences of all ages.

Disney+ also features a growing collection of original holiday movies and specials, often starring beloved characters from their animated franchises. This makes it a great option for families looking for fresh and engaging content to enjoy together during the holiday season. Hallmark Movies Now: All Christmas, All the Time
For those who can’t get enough of feel-good holiday romance, Hallmark Movies Now is the ultimate destination. This streaming service is dedicated entirely to Hallmark’s signature brand of heartwarming Christmas movies, offering a constant stream of festive cheer. Expect predictable plots, charming small towns, and plenty of snow-dusted romance.

While Hallmark Christmas movies may not be for everyone, they have a dedicated following who appreciate their wholesome entertainment and comforting predictability. If you’re looking for a guaranteed dose of holiday spirit, Hallmark Movies Now is a safe bet. Just be prepared for plenty of cheesy dialogue and unrealistic scenarios! Other Streaming Options for Holiday Movie Lovers
While the big streaming services dominate the landscape, there are several other options worth considering for holiday movie enthusiasts. Here are a few to check out:
* Hulu: Offers a selection of holiday movies, including classics and some original productions, often bundled with live TV options.
* HBO Max: Features a smaller but curated collection of Christmas movies, including some high-quality animated specials.
* Criterion Channel: For those seeking more sophisticated and arthouse holiday fare, the Criterion Channel occasionally features classic holiday films with a unique twist. (Think less “Elf,” more “A Christmas Tale” by Arnaud Desplechin).

Don’t forget about free streaming services like Tubi and Pluto TV, which often offer a surprising selection of holiday movies, albeit with commercials. And if you’re feeling adventurous, consider checking out your local library’s streaming service. Many libraries offer access to a variety of films and TV shows, including Christmas movies, completely free of charge. “I was surprised to find some great holiday movies on my library’s streaming service,” says David, a budget-conscious movie buff. “It’s a great way to save money and still enjoy festive films.”
Tips for Finding the Best Holiday Movies to Watch
Navigating the world of holiday movies can be overwhelming, with countless options available across various streaming platforms. Here are a few tips to help you find the perfect films to watch this season:
1. Use Search Filters: Most streaming services offer search filters that allow you to narrow down your options by genre, release year, and rating. Use these filters to find Christmas movies that match your specific interests.
2. Read Reviews: Before committing to a movie, take a moment to read reviews from critics and other viewers. This can help you avoid duds and discover hidden gems.
3. Check Ratings: Pay attention to movie ratings, especially if you’re watching with children. Some holiday movies may contain mature themes or content that is not suitable for all ages.
4. Explore Recommendations: Many streaming services offer personalized recommendations based on your viewing history. Take advantage of these features to discover new holiday movies that you might enjoy.
5. Don’t Be Afraid to Try Something New: Step outside your comfort zone and try a Christmas movie you’ve never seen before. You might just discover a new favorite!
